Final requirements

Presentation of each student’s original project in graphic form on 50x50 or 50x100cm boards. If it is necessary the model should be added.

The designed functional and artistic solutions for space should be presented according to the chosen user with using proper scale and original artistic means.

The short story about user and student’s idea for designed space is required and all used materials and elements chosen for interior design (furniture, equipment and lighting elements etc.) should be presented in form of A3 book.

Student also prepares a model and photos from the short monthly task – reception in the public space.

Teaching goals (program content, subject description)

Motivate students to understand the interior design - based on studies of space and the users characteristic;

To persuade them to make independent decisions regarding the capability of space, functionality of solutions with regard to legal norms and construction issues.

Teaching and discuss of students choices and selection of artistic means and methods of visual communication adequate to their ideas.
